Overview
- Berlin defeated ThSV Eisenach at the Max-Schmeling-Halle in a deserved home win.
- The result pushed the champions' run to four consecutive competitive victories.
- Nicolej Krickau's team controlled proceedings with a disciplined, composed display despite pregame talk of a hectic matchup.
- On-loan Füchse product Max Beneke saw a seven-meter throw saved by goalkeeper Lasse Ludwig before 8,509 spectators.
- Berlin next host HSG Wetzlar in the DHB-Pokal on Wednesday in Potsdam at 19:00, with live coverage on Dyn.
